Our Staff

Otto Nielson discovered his two new loves at New Saint Andrews College, where he was pursuing his Bachelor’s Degree in Classical Liberal Arts and Culture. The first new love was Bethany, now his wife. The second was the art of creating a symphony for the palate. It began with an elective in Aesthetic Gastronomy. That led to an apprenticeship in Culinary Arts under French Chef Francis Foucachon.

After working in restaurants specializing in Northwest cuisine, Otto has arrived at the RimRock Inn Restaurant, where he will add an element of Basque cuisine, as well as a special expertise on wine selection.

Having been raised on the family ranch in Northeast Washington, Otto looks forward to life on the edge of the deep canyons of Northeast Oregon. Otto finds inspiration from his wife Bethany, an artist and teacher, and their very young son, Bredon, who will eat anything.
